Hawaii Extended Forecast Discussion NWS Weather Prediction Center College Park MD 817 AM EDT Mon Aug 10 2015 Valid 00Z Tue Aug 11 2015 - 00Z Tue Aug 18 2015 ...Heavy rain possible later this week as Hurricane Hilda approaches the islands in weakened form... *** Please consult the CPHC for the latest forecast information on Hilda *** Quiet pattern in the short term will give way to increased rain chances later this week as current Hurricane Hilda continues to approach the islands. The latest CPHC track takes the system over the southern part of the Big Island mostly in between the 00Z GFS and ECMWF. Though the ensembles still diverge to the north and south around the islands later this week, all indicate a rise in PW values to between 1.50-3.00" inches, clustered around 2-2.25" (again in between the 00Z GFS and ECMWF). Model/ensemble QPF on the eastern side of the islands (and in lower elevations) range from about 1-12" with the best clustering between about 3-4" and again around 5-7". A track westward along 20N would likely yield higher rather than lower rainfall amounts, with >12" in the higher elevations quite possible. The system (in remnant form) should continue to pull away from the islands Sunday into Monday but PW values may remain above average despite upper ridging forecast to build into the region. Fracasso
